For most adults, holding a static stretch for 15 to 30 seconds is the sweet spot. That’s the range where the greatest gains in flexibility occur, and most research supports repeating each stretch 2 to 4 times per muscle group. But the ideal hold time shifts depending on your age, your goals, and when you’re stretching relative to exercise.
The 15-to-30-Second Standard
The most widely cited guideline is to hold each stretch for 15 to 30 seconds. This recommendation comes from decades of flexibility research showing that the biggest change in range of motion happens within that window. Holding for less than 15 seconds doesn’t give your muscle enough time to relax and lengthen. Holding much longer than 30 seconds offers diminishing returns for younger, healthy adults.
For a typical stretching session, aim for 2 to 4 repetitions of each stretch. So if you’re stretching your hamstrings, you’d hold for 30 seconds, release, then repeat that two or three more times before moving on. A full-body routine targeting the major muscle groups usually takes about 10 to 15 minutes at this pace.
Older Adults Benefit From Longer Holds
If you’re over 65, holding stretches for 60 seconds produces noticeably better results. A study of adults aged 65 to 93 compared 15-second, 30-second, and 60-second hamstring stretches performed five days a week over six weeks. The 60-second group gained flexibility at roughly four times the rate of the 15-second group (2.4 degrees per week versus 0.6 degrees). Those gains also stuck around longer: four weeks after the stretching program ended, the 60-second group still retained 5.4 degrees of improved range of motion, while the shorter-duration groups retained less than one degree.
Age-related changes in connective tissue stiffness and muscle elasticity explain the difference. Older tissues simply need more time under a sustained stretch to adapt. If you’re in this age range, the extra time per stretch is well worth it.
Before a Workout, Timing Matters More
Static stretching before explosive activities like sprinting, jumping, or heavy lifting can temporarily reduce your power output, but only if you hold too long. Research measuring muscle force production found that holds of 10 or 20 seconds caused no significant loss in strength. At 30 seconds, though, peak force dropped by about 5 to 8 percent. At 60 seconds, it dropped by 10 to 16 percent, depending on the speed of the movement.
The practical takeaway: if you stretch statically before a workout, keep your holds under 30 seconds per muscle group. Better yet, save your longer static stretches for after exercise and use dynamic stretching to warm up. Dynamic stretches, where you move through a range of motion repeatedly rather than holding a position, are better suited for pre-workout preparation. A typical dynamic warm-up takes 8 to 10 minutes and involves controlled movements like leg swings, walking lunges, or arm circles performed over a short distance.
Building Long-Term Flexibility
If your goal is to permanently increase your range of motion rather than just loosen up for a single session, you need a higher weekly volume of stretching. An international panel of stretching researchers recommends 2 to 3 sets per day, with each set held for 30 to 120 seconds per muscle group. That’s a significant step up from the standard 15-to-30-second guideline, and it reflects the difference between maintenance stretching and a dedicated flexibility program.
Static stretching and PNF stretching (where you alternate between contracting and relaxing a muscle while stretching it) are both more effective than dynamic stretching for building lasting flexibility. The key variable is total weekly volume. Stretching a muscle group for a few minutes every day, consistently over weeks, produces cumulative tissue changes that a few quick stretches before the gym never will. If you’re working toward a specific flexibility goal like touching your toes or doing a full split, daily practice with longer holds is the path.
How Hard Should You Push?
You should feel a clear pull or tension in the muscle, but not sharp pain. Beyond that simple guideline, the science on stretching intensity is surprisingly unsettled. Researchers haven’t agreed on a standardized way to measure or prescribe how hard a stretch should feel, partly because pain and discomfort thresholds vary enormously from person to person.
In practice, aim for a sensation you’d describe as moderate tension, somewhere between “I barely feel this” and “this hurts.” The stretch should be strong enough that you notice your range of motion gradually increasing as you hold it, but not so aggressive that your muscles tense up in resistance. If you find yourself holding your breath or clenching, you’ve gone too far. Back off slightly and let the muscle release on its own.
Quick Reference by Goal
- General flexibility maintenance: 15 to 30 seconds per stretch, 2 to 4 repetitions, at least 2 to 3 days per week
- Pre-workout warm-up: Dynamic stretches for 8 to 10 minutes, or static holds under 30 seconds if preferred
- Post-workout cooldown: 30 to 60 seconds per stretch, 2 to 4 repetitions
- Dedicated flexibility training: 30 to 120 seconds per set, 2 to 3 sets daily, focusing on static or PNF stretching
- Adults over 65: 60 seconds per stretch for the best results in range of motion gains
